International orientation of the study programme design (Asterisk- Criterion)

In the previous section (Chapter 0.1), it is explained that FISIP’s vision and missions are designed by referring to the Unpad’s strategic plan and orientation, including the goals to be globally acknowledged for providing an education service to international standards. Each study programme is specifically designed with an international orientation by considering its uniqueness and strengths, so that students have the knowledge and skills needed to compete internationally in both academic and professional settings. The main features of this international orientation strategy are:

  1. development of courses conducted in the English medium;
  2. hosting international guest lectures, joint lectures and lecture series, and inviting external supervision and examination, in collaboration with international partners;
  3. hosting international conferences, seminars, symposiums, and summer courses;
  4. developing international research networks through collaborative research project and joint publication;
  5. facilitating the international mobility of students and academics (i.e. student exchanges, academic exchanges, academic training, international internships); and
  6. administrative support for students’ and academics’ international activities;
  7. benchmarking strategy and capacity

The specific designs of international orientation strategy in each study programme is elaborated below.

 

Master of Public Administration

The study program further encourages the integration of intercultural elements into its classes, including the simultaneous usage of Indonesian and English. In order to support the internationalisation of the study programme, the programme has held international classes in collaboration with international partners including with 67 students from South Korea, 6 from Timor Leste and 1 from Afghanistan. In addition, educational and research collaboration contracts have been entered into, including with Flinders University, Waseda University, and Tohoku University. Additionally, this study program welcomes foreign guest lecturers on a range of topics. The introduction of foreign guest speakers broadens students’ awareness of diverse viewpoints from throughout the world. Similarly, the participation of foreign students gives Master of Public Administration study program participants the expertise and abilities to engage and build global networks.
